WebAug 17, 2024 · The growth of the cutaneous horn is initiated in 50% by benign processes, in 23-27% by actinic keratoses (precancerous) and in 20% by malignant tumors. Pathology is more common in light-skinned men in the age range from 60-70 years. Formations with malignant potential are detected at the age of 70 and older.
